Meaning of pre-Code | Babel Free

Adjective CEFR B2

Definitions

Prior to the introduction of the Hays Code, a set of moral guidelines for the US film industry widely applied between 1930 and 1968.

not-comparable

Examples

“The Sign of the Cross, in certain senses the ultimate pre-Code movie, can still have a queasying ^([sic]) effect on viewers with its arena brutality, and its effect on 1933 audiences was that much stronger”
